Mission

The mission of the david adler cultural center d/b/a adler arts center (the center) is to advance and nurture the diverse cultural interests of the people of northern illinois and southern wisconsin. A not-for-profit organization, the center provides a spectrum of performing and learning opportunities for children and adults in classical, traditional and folk music, and in the visual arts. The center seeks, through education, research and service, to enrich the personal and artistic lives of members of the communities it serves. While providing these programs, the center is maintaining and restoring the historic home of architect david adler.

Programs

3 programs

Art classes - provide a variety of art and architectural classes allowing artists to explore creativitiy and learn new skills. Students learn fundamental art concepts and skills.

Expenses: $40K

Music lessons-provide a variety of learning opportunities on a variety of instruments and styles to over 450 students per week.

Expenses: $484K

Art exhibits - enrich cultural and artistic lives of the community through exhibits featuring amateur and professional artists.

Expenses: $41K
